If I'm not craving for pizza, it'd be chocolates. (Or ice cream, or burgers, or sashimi, and a whole bunch of other things, but whatever.) And Sony Asia isn't helping! Guess what they've got lined up for PlayStation Home Asia's Valentine's Day celebration?
It's a whole chunk of chocolate (cue Homer J. Simpson: Mmm, chocolate...) collectibles, from a chocolate replica of the Home Square all the way up to marshmallow shirts and furniture dipped in chocolate fondue. (cue Homer J. Simpson: Mmm, furniture dipped in chocolate fondue...)
The special clothes and furniture are actually available for a price at the Mall, but the Square replica is free. Mmm...
The entire celebration kicked off the other day and ends tomorrow. Part of the press release also indicates a chocolate fountain! Wooohooo!
